Thin films of polypyrrole doped with different counter-ions, prepared by in
situ polymerization on conducting glass electrodes, are used for the devel
opment of gas sensors with fast response time. On exposure to a given vapor
, each individual film exhibits a fast change in the fractional difference
of its electrical resistivity and with the adopted arrays of 7 sensors it w
as possible to detect and identify simple organic solvents. The morphology
and structure of the films, and therefore the level of response to the vola
tile compounds, is determined by the structure of the counter-ion used.
